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.
Richtlinien für die Unterstützung von AWS Glue-Versionen
AWS Glue ist ein Serverless-Datenintegrationsdienst, der es einfach macht, Daten für Analytik, Machine Learning und Anwendungsentwicklung zu erkennen, vorzubereiten und zu kombinieren. Ein AWS Glue-Auftrag enthält die Geschäftslogik, die die Datenintegrationsarbeit in AWS Glue. Es gibt drei Arten von Aufträgen in AWS Glue: Spark (Batch und Streaming), Ray und Python-Shell. Beim Definieren Ihres Auftrags geben Sie die AWS Glue-Version an, die Versionen in der zugrunde liegenden Spark-, Ray- oder Python-Laufzeitumgebung konfiguriert. Beispiel: Ein Spark-Auftrag der AWS Glue-Version 2.0 unterstützt Spark 2.4.3 und Python 3.7.
Support-Richtlinie
AWS Glue Versionen basieren auf einer Kombination aus Betriebssystem, Programmiersprache und Softwarebibliotheken, die Wartungs- und Sicherheitsupdates unterliegen. AWS Glue Die Richtlinie zur Versionsunterstützung sieht vor, dass der Support für eine Version eingestellt wird, wenn für eine wichtige Komponente der Version der Community Long-Term Support (LTS) ausläuft und keine Sicherheitsupdates mehr verfügbar sind. Nach dem Ende des Support (EOS) für eine Version AWS Glue dürfen keine Sicherheitspatches oder andere Updates mehr auf EOS-Versionen angewendet werden. AWS Glue Jobs mit EOS-Versionen haben keinen Anspruch auf technischen Support. AWS Glue erfüllt möglicherweise auch nicht die SLAs, wenn Jobs auf EOS-Versionen ausgeführt werden.
Die folgenden AWS Glue-Versionen haben das Ende des Supports erreicht oder es ist geplant: Ende des Supports beginnt um Mitternacht (pazifische Zeitzone) am angegebenen Datum.
Typ | Glue Version | Ende des Supports |
---|---|---|
Spark | Spark 2.2, Scala 2 (Glue Version 0.9) | 01.06.2022 |
Spark | Spark 2.2, Python 2 (Glue Version 0.9) | 1.6.2022 |
Spark | Spark 2.4, Python 2 (Glue Version 1.0) | 1.6.2022 |
Spark | Spark 2.4, Python 3 (Glue Version 1.0) | 30.9.2022 |
Spark | Spark 2.4, Scala 2 (Glue Version 1.0) | 30.9.2022 |
Spark | Glue Version 2.0 | 31.1.2024 |
Typ | Python-Version | Ende des Supports |
Python-Shell | Python 2 (Glue Version 1.0) | 1.6.2022 |
Typ | Notebook-Version | Ende des Supports |
Entwicklungsendpunkt | Zeppelin Notebook | 30.9.2022 |
AWS empfiehlt dringend, Ihre Aufträge auf unterstützte Versionen zu migrieren.
Informationen zur Migration Ihrer Spark-Aufträge auf die neueste AWS Glue-Version finden Sie unter Migrieren von AWS Glue-Aufträgen auf AWS Glue-Version 4.0.
Migrieren Ihrer Python-Shell-Aufträge auf die neueste AWS Glue-Version:
Wählen Sie in der Konsole
Python 3 (Glue Version 4.0)
aus.-
Setzen Sie in der CreateJob/UpdateJobAPI den
GlueVersion
Parameter auf2.0
und den WertPythonVersion
auf3
unter demCommand
Parameter. DieGlueVersion
Konfiguration hat keinen Einfluss auf das Verhalten von Python-Shell-Jobs, sodass das InkrementierenGlueVersion
keinen Vorteil hat. Sie müssen Ihr Auftragsskript mit Python 3 kompatibel machen.